Sheridan Capital Partners has completed an investment in Carolina Components Group, a provider of custom-engineered bioprocessing assemblies and components for the manufacturing of biopharmaceuticals. The transaction was led by Houlihan Lokey as financial advisor to both parties and Kirkland & Ellis LLP as legal counsel to Sheridan.

Strategic rationale

Sheridan’s investment in CCG aims to accelerate growth and leverage its expertise within the biopharmaceutical manufacturing supply chain. Maurice Phelan, a seasoned leader with extensive experience in the bioprocessing sector, has been named CEO of Carolina Components Group.

Outlook

The partnership between Sheridan Capital Partners and CCG is expected to enhance operational efficiency and expand the company’s offerings within its customer base, which includes over 250 biopharmaceutical and contract manufacturing companies. With the expertise of Maurice Phelan and strategic guidance from Sheridan, Carolina Components Group is poised for significant growth.
